Tenille Joy Lindeque
Founder, Principal Teacher, and Performer

 

 

 

 

I started dancing as a little girl, first ballet and then modern dance. As a teenager, looking forward to my daily dance classes got me through the long tedious days at school in Knysna. At the age of 16, I started teaching aerobics classes for my Godmother, Briony, and when I finished school I moved to Cape Town and completed my training as an aerobics instructor and personal trainer through the ETA at the Sports Science Institute in Newlands.

In 2000 I met my first belly dance teacher, Dawn Kennedy. I attended classes with Dawn on and off for a year and became increasingly passionate about the beautiful, ancient dance form. Having spent my teen years living on apples in the hopes of getting thinner, I was delighted to find a dance form that embraced the natural curves of a woman's body.

I later danced with Natasha Van Der Merwe, of The Hip Circle studio, and was impressed by her dynamic stage presence and graceful movements. Natasha's style suited me and I began teaching a creative dance class at Dakini health and wellness studio. This class, along with my regular aerobics classes, gradually progressed from grapevines and V steps to shimmies and undulations.

In 2003 Dakini closed and I decided to open my own studio ... teaching stretch and tone classes ... but it was not to be. Destiny prevailed and soon my students were requesting belly dance lessons. And so The Feminine Divine was born! So from 3 die hard Dakini students the studio has now grown to over 300 members... all Goddesses who are a part of the Feminine Divine family!

Tiffany Lindeque - Teacher and Performer


Tiffany Kim Lindeque is Tenille's little sister. She has danced since she learned to walk and has studied ballet, tap, modern and Latin dance. She began teaching Latin dance in Knysna for her dance teacher, Celeste in 2008 and moved to Cape Town at the beginning of 2010 to join her sister on the Feminine Divine team. Spending a grueling number of hours a day in the studio with Tenille, shimmying, undulating and giggling up a storm, Tiffany soon began receiving compliments about her dancing that Tenille could either choose to acknowledge with pride, or begin to feel jealous of! Fortunately she chose the former! :-)  Apart from one on one private training with Tenille, Tiffany participated in 2 intense training workshops in 2010, namely with Belly Dance Superstar, Ansuya, and with Samantha Emanuel.

 

While Tiffany loves to samba, salsa and cha cha to the fiery grooves of Latin america, she has found her true calling as a bellydancer and adds a special fiery energy to the studio.
